#398E73 Color
#398E73 is rgb(57, 142, 115) in RGB, hsl(161, 43%, 39%) in HSL, and about cmyk(60%, 0%, 19%, 44%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Illuminating Emerald (#319177),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 2.55.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#398E73 Channel Values
How #398E73 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 57 · G 142 · B 115 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 161° · S 43% · L 39%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 161° · S 60% · V 56%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 60% · M 0% · Y 19% · K 44%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.97:1 vs white · 5.29: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#398E73 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#398E73?
#398E73 is a dark green — rgb(57, 142, 115) in RGB and hsl(161, 43%, 39%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Illuminating Emerald (#319177),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 2.55.
What is the RGB value of #398E73?
#398E73 is rgb(57, 142, 115) — red 57, green 142, and blue 115 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#398E73?
#398E73 converts to approximately cmyk(60%, 0%, 19%, 44%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#398E73 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#398E73 scores 3.97:1 against white and 5.29: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#398E73 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#398E73 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is seagreen (#2E8B57) at a CIE76 distance of 14.54, which is visibly different.
